Steven
|
This is Steven. Steven is seven years old, and he lives in Vila Ulongue, Tete, Mozambique with his uncle, his aunt Betanie, his brother Fombe (12 years old) and his sister Ana (eight years old).
Steven's father and mother have both died in the last two years. His father was a carpenter. Steven's aunt Betanie thinks that Steven's mother and father died of a disease called AIDS that affects the lives of many people in Mozambique. Steven has been very sick since his mother died. Recently, the doctor did a blood test and found out that Steven also has AIDS. He has been taking Antiretroviral (ARV) medications since that test. His aunt says the ARVs are helping Steven because he hasn't been feeling sick since he started taking them. Betanie starts each day by asking Steven how he feels. If he isn't feeling well, they go to the hospital to get advice. She also gives him ARVs every day at 6 AM and again at 6 PM. The ARVs are free but Steven still suffers because he needs to eat lots of good fruits and vegetables, which his family struggles to afford. His brother and sister are still HIV negative, although they will be tested again soon to be certain of their health.
The house that Steven and his family live in now is made of mud and does not have a roof. They hope that they will soon be able to move into Steven's mother's old house on the other side of the village, where they will not have to pay rent. Steven doesn't go to school. He was supposed to go, but when it was time to register at school he was in the hospital because he was very sick. When Betanie went to register him, the principal said they were too late and would have to wait until next year.
Though they have many struggles, Steven and his family are very hopeful. His uncle is a salesman who walks around the village selling clothes from Malawi. Steven's aunt Betanie takes care of him, his siblings, and his cousins every day. She is very determined to help Steven and the rest of the family live a healthy life.
